Understanding QR Code Sizes
QR codes consist of a grid of black and white squares, with the smallest unit being a module. The size of a QR code is typically measured in modules, with the smallest version being 21x21 modules (Version 1) and the largest being 177x177 modules (Version 40). However, the size of a QR code in terms of physical dimensions can vary greatly depending on the version and the printing resolution.
Factors Affecting QR Code Scannability
Several factors can impact the scannability of a QR code, including:

- Size: The physical size of the QR code can affect its readability, especially if it's too small or too large.
- Printing Quality: A poor-quality print can make it difficult for scanners to read the code.
- Contrast: The contrast between the black and white areas of the QR code should be high for easy scanning.
- Background: The background of the QR code should be a solid color that contrasts with the code itself.

Best Practices for Ensuring QR Code Scannability
In addition to ensuring the right size, there are several best practices that can help ensure your QR codes are scannable:

- Use high-contrast colors (black and white or dark and light shades).
- Ensure the QR code has a solid background that contrasts with the code itself.
- Leave sufficient space around the QR code to prevent interference with the edges.
- Test your QR codes thoroughly to ensure they scan reliably.
